About FRANKS
FRANKS is a calorie-dense food with 304 calories per 100-gram serving. Its primary macronutrient source is fat, providing 12.5g of protein, 1.8g of carbohydrates, and 25g of fat. This food belongs to the Sausages, Hotdogs & Brats category.
Ingredients
MECHANICALLY SEPARATED CHICKEN, PORK, WATER, SALT, CONTAINS LESS THAN 2% OF DEXTROSE, CORN SYRUP, SODIUM PHOSPHATE, MODIFIED FOOD STARCH, FLAVORING, SUGAR, SODIUM ERYTHORBATE, OLEORESIN OF PAPRIKA, SODIUM NITRITE.
